Abstract
Northeastern University organizes a May Institute on Computation and Statistics for Quantitative Proteomics. The Institute will train life scientists and computational scientists in designing and analyzing large-scale experiments relying on proteomics, metabolomics, and other high-throughput mass spectrometry-based bimolecular assays. The Institute will consist of several modules that span 2.5 days, which cover processing data from quantitative mass spectrometric experiments, management, visualization and statistical analysis of these data in R, and case studies in design and analysis of quantitative mass spectrometry-based experiments.
